Viking Age Swords at the Army Museum in Paris, France
A deep dive look at the Viking Age swords at the Musée de l'Armée, a national military museum in Paris, France. I discuss typology, construction, and origin of all these swords, and try to give a unique perspective that hopefully assists other amateur historians and sword-makers like myself.
